What are the different states of matter? 🔊
The different states of matter are solid, liquid, gas, and plasma. Solids have a fixed shape and volume, liquids take the shape of their container while maintaining volume, gases have neither fixed shape nor volume, and plasma is a high-energy state with free electrons and ions. Additionally, materials can transition between these states through physical changes like melting, freezing, evaporation, and condensation.
